Mukti Parv Diwas    

‘Mukti Parv’ - the festival of Spiritual freedom observed by Sant Nirankari Mission on 15th August organized at about 50 places in and around Mumbai.


Mumbai, August 21, 2023 : While India celebrated its 77th Independence Day, the Nirankari fraternity observed this day as a festival of Spiritual freedom and addressed it as 'Mukti Parv'. On this occasion, special satsang programs were organized in all the branches of the Mission across the country.

In the Mumbai Metropolitan Region, ‘Mukti Parv’ was observed at about 50 branches of Sant Nirankari Mission in Mumbai city, suburbs, Thane, Navi Mumbai, Panvel, Uran, Bhayandar, Vasai-Virar, Dombivli, Kalyan, Ulhasnagar, Ambernath, Badlapur, Shahapur etc., where large number of followers congregated.

On this occasion, devotees paid homage to the former spiritual heads of the Mission viz Shehanshah Baba Avtar Singh Ji, Jagat Mata Budhwanti Ji, Nirankari Rajmata Kulwant Kaur Ji, Satguru Mata Savinder Hardev Ji and all the dedicated devotees who upon experiencing the divine light themselves revealed it to others, too. Mukti Parv Samagam was first held on August 15, 1964 in the memory of Jagat Mata Budhwanti Ji, the spouse of Shehanshah Baba Avtar Singh Ji. Shehanshah Ji himself was a living icon of service, who devoted his entire life, selflessly serving to the mission. After his heavenly abode in 1969, this day was addressed as 'Shehanshah-Jagatmata Diwas'. In 1979, when the first Pradhan of Sant Nirankari Mandal, Labh Singh Ji left his mortal body, Baba Gurbachan Singh Ji named this day as 'Mukti Parv'.

Pujya Mata Savinder Hardev Ji left her mortal body on 5th August, 2018. She took the reins of the mission in the form of Satguru in the year 2016 and prior to that, she continuously supported Baba Hardev Singh ji in every field for 36 years and drenched every devotee with her love.
